Backlog Management

What is Backlog Management?

Backlog management is the process of organizing and prioritizing tasks that need to be completed within a project. It helps teams to focus on the most important work, ensuring that they deliver the best results in a timely manner.

Understanding Backlog Management

In agile methodologies, the backlog is a list of tasks, features, or updates that need attention. Backlog management involves:

  • Prioritizing Tasks: Team members decide which tasks are the most important and should be worked on first.
  • Updating the Backlog: As new tasks come up or priorities change, the backlog is continually updated to reflect what needs to be done.
  • Refining Tasks: Team members break down larger tasks into smaller, manageable pieces. This makes it easier to tackle each part effectively.
  • Creating Clarity: A well-managed backlog provides clarity for the whole team, making sure everyone knows what to work on next.

Importance of Backlog Management

Backlog management helps teams to:

  1. Stay Focused: By knowing what tasks are most important, teams can concentrate their efforts on high-priority items.
  2. Improve Communication: A clear backlog allows for better discussion among team members. Everyone understands what needs to be done.
  3. Increase Efficiency: Properly managing the backlog ensures that teams spend less time on unnecessary tasks and more time on what truly matters.
  4. Enhance Flexibility: Agile teams need to be adaptable. An updated backlog allows teams to adjust quickly to new information or changes in priorities.

Key Practices for Effective Backlog Management

To manage a backlog effectively, consider these best practices:

  • Regular Reviews: Hold regular meetings to review and update the backlog. This keeps it relevant and useful.
  • Engage the Team: Involve all team members in backlog discussions. Different perspectives can help identify the most pressing tasks.
  • Use Simple Language: Write tasks clearly and simply, so everyone understands what needs to be done.

Why Assess a Candidate’s Backlog Management Skills?

Assessing a candidate's backlog management skills is important for several reasons:

  1. Efficiency in Project Work: A candidate skilled in backlog management can help teams work more efficiently. They know how to prioritize tasks, which means the most important work gets done first. This leads to faster project completion and better results.

  2. Clear Communication: Good backlog management requires strong communication skills. A candidate who excels in this area can make sure everyone on the team understands what needs to be done. This helps reduce confusion and keeps everyone on the same page.

  3. Adaptability to Change: Agile projects often change direction based on new information. A candidate with strong backlog management skills can adjust priorities quickly. This adaptability is key in fast-paced work environments.

  4. Team Collaboration: Assessing backlog management skills also gives insight into how well a candidate can work with others. A good backlog manager collaborates with team members to update tasks and refine goals, fostering a positive team dynamic.

  5. Success in Agile Environments: Many modern companies use agile methodologies. Candidates who understand backlog management can contribute significantly to these teams. This skill is essential for anyone looking to succeed in an agile work culture.

Overall, evaluating a candidate's backlog management skills helps ensure you hire someone who can contribute to the success of your projects and the effectiveness of your team.

How to Assess Candidates on Backlog Management

Assessing candidates on their backlog management skills is crucial for ensuring they can effectively contribute to your agile team. Here are a couple of methods to evaluate these skills:

1. Practical Scenario Tests

One effective way to assess backlog management skills is through practical scenario tests. In these tests, candidates can be presented with a set of project tasks that need to be prioritized. Ask them to prioritize these tasks based on importance and urgency. This exercise helps you see their thought process and how they handle real-world situations. Candidates can demonstrate their understanding of backlog management through clear reasoning and prioritization techniques.

2. Case Study Analysis

Another excellent method is to use case study analysis. Provide candidates with a case study of a project facing backlog challenges. Ask them to identify issues and suggest improvements for backlog management. This type of assessment showcases their ability to analyze scenarios, understand the agile framework, and propose effective solutions. It emphasizes strategic thinking and understanding of backlog dynamics.

Using Alooba for Assessment

Alooba offers an efficient platform to conduct these assessments. With customizable tests and scenarios, you can easily evaluate candidates' backlog management skills in a structured environment. Create practical scenario tests and case study analyses specific to your company’s needs, helping you find the best talent for your team.

By using these assessment methods, you can gain valuable insights into a candidate’s effectiveness in backlog management, ensuring you select someone who can help your team thrive.

Topics and Subtopics in Backlog Management

Understanding backlog management involves several key topics and subtopics. This structured approach can help teams implement effective backlog management strategies. Here are the main topics and their relevant subtopics:

1. Definition of Backlog Management

  • What is a backlog?
  • Importance of backlog management in agile methodologies

2. Components of a Backlog

  • User stories
  • Tasks and sub-tasks
  • Bugs and technical debt
  • Features and enhancements

3. Prioritization Techniques

  • MoSCoW Method (Must have, Should have, Could have, Won't have)
  • Weighted Shortest Job First (WSJF)
  • Kano Model for prioritizing tasks
  • Stakeholder input and feedback

4. Backlog Refinement

  • Regular backlog grooming sessions
  • Breaking down large tasks into smaller ones
  • Estimating task effort and complexity
  • Ensuring clarity and understanding of tasks

5. Tools and Techniques for Backlog Management

  • Software tools for backlog tracking (e.g., Jira, Trello)
  • Agile boards and Kanban methodology
  • Using spreadsheets for simpler setups

6. Monitoring and Revising the Backlog

  • Regular check-ins and reviews
  • Adjusting priorities based on team performance and project needs
  • Communicating changes to the team

7. Best Practices for Effective Backlog Management

  • Involving the entire team in backlog discussions
  • Keeping the backlog transparent and accessible
  • Setting clear goals and success measures

By exploring these topics and subtopics, teams can better understand the principles of backlog management. This knowledge helps ensure projects run smoothly and efficiently, leading to successful outcomes in an agile environment.

How Backlog Management is Used

Backlog management is a critical practice in agile project management that helps teams streamline their work processes and effectively deliver results. Here’s how backlog management is used in practice:

1. Prioritizing Work

In backlog management, tasks, features, and user stories are organized based on their importance and urgency. Teams prioritize the backlog to focus on delivering the highest value items first. This ensures that the most critical tasks get completed on time, allowing the team to meet deadlines and exceed stakeholder expectations.

2. Enhancing Team Collaboration

Backlog management encourages collaboration among team members. Regular backlog refinement meetings involve the entire team in discussions about tasks, priorities, and upcoming work. This collaboration fosters open communication and helps build a shared understanding of project goals and challenges.

3. Adapting to Changes

In agile methodologies, projects often change direction based on new insights or feedback from stakeholders. Backlog management allows teams to adapt quickly by updating priorities and re-evaluating tasks. This flexibility ensures that the team can respond to changes and shifting requirements while maintaining progress.

4. Improving Workflow Efficiency

Effective backlog management leads to a more efficient workflow. By breaking larger tasks into smaller, manageable pieces, teams can tackle their workload more easily. This approach minimizes overwhelm and keeps team members focused on completing individual tasks before moving on to the next item.

5. Supporting Continuous Improvement

Backlog management is not a one-time task; it requires ongoing attention and review. By regularly assessing the backlog and its priorities, teams can identify areas for improvement. This practice encourages continuous learning and adaptation, making it easier to refine processes and enhance overall productivity.

Roles That Require Good Backlog Management Skills

Backlog management skills are essential for various roles within an organization, especially those involved in agile project management and product development. Here are some key roles that benefit from strong backlog management skills:

1. Product Owner

The Product Owner is responsible for defining the vision of the product and prioritizing the backlog to ensure that the team delivers maximum value. Their ability to manage and refine the backlog is crucial for aligning the team’s work with stakeholder expectations.

2. Scrum Master

The Scrum Master facilitates agile processes and helps the team smooth out any obstacles. Good backlog management skills are necessary for Scrum Masters to guide the team in proper task prioritization and to keep the backlog organized and up-to-date.

3. Agile Team Member

Members of an agile team, including developers and designers, must understand backlog management to effectively contribute to project goals. Team members play a key role in refining and executing tasks from the backlog. Thus, their ability to manage work efficiently is vital.

4. Project Manager

While not always within agile frameworks, a Project Manager often oversees multiple projects and teams. Strong backlog management skills aid in prioritizing tasks across projects, ensuring alignment with overall business objectives and timely completion.

5. Business Analyst

A Business Analyst bridges the gap between stakeholders and technical teams. Effective backlog management skills are important for capturing requirements accurately and prioritizing them in the backlog to reflect business needs.

6. UX/UI Designer

A UX/UI Designer must collaborate closely with other team members to ensure that design tasks are prioritized appropriately within the backlog. Their input is essential in making sure that user experience considerations are reflected in the project’s priorities.

By focusing on these roles, organizations can ensure that individuals with strong backlog management skills contribute significantly to successful agile project outcomes.

Associated Roles

Product Manager

Product Manager

A Product Manager is a strategic leader responsible for guiding the development and lifecycle of a product from conception to launch. They collaborate with cross-functional teams, prioritize features, and ensure that the product meets customer needs while aligning with business objectives.

Assess Your Candidates with Confidence

Schedule a Discovery Call Today!

Using Alooba to assess candidates in backlog management ensures you find the right talent for your agile team. Our platform offers tailored assessments that accurately measure candidates' skills, helping you make informed hiring decisions. Discover how easy it is to evaluate backlog management proficiency and contribute to your team's success.

Our Customers Say

Play
Quote
We get a high flow of applicants, which leads to potentially longer lead times, causing delays in the pipelines which can lead to missing out on good candidates. Alooba supports both speed and quality. The speed to return to candidates gives us a competitive advantage. Alooba provides a higher level of confidence in the people coming through the pipeline with less time spent interviewing unqualified candidates.

Scott Crowe, Canva (Lead Recruiter - Data)